£284,600
+24% month on month
Tracking 8% over target
Operational reporting and delivery analytics built on an append-only ledger: every load, sale, payment and reading posts to source, then surfaces as live dashboards. Drill from a balance to the geo-stamp.















A handful of patterns show up in almost every operation still stitching reports together by hand — and at least one of them is yours.
Drivers come back; somebody exports; somebody pivots; somebody emails. By the time the morning meeting reads the numbers, the day is half gone and the variance is already cold.
The aged-debt list says a customer owes £8,200. Why? Which invoices? Was a cheque deposited? Who took the cash? The spreadsheet can’t answer — only a phone call to the rep can.
Strike rate, delivered ratio, returns rate, commission accuracy — you know who’s strong and who’s slipping, but you can’t show it on a screen and the driver can’t see it either.
External audit, recall query, tax inspection: someone disappears for a week to assemble PDFs, dockets and emails into a binder. And the answer is still ‘to the best of our knowledge’.
Delivery reporting and fleet management dashboards built on append-only ledgers, not flattened exports.

Treat every stock movement as a ledger entry, so you can walk back to the document, driver and timestamp. Recall queries answer in seconds, per product or per bin.

Keep a running balance per customer, with due and overpaid views side by side. The per-branch cash ledger reconciles the Branch Deposit before anyone goes home.

Route analytics that compare plan against delivered per route, with two runs side by side, and a per-driver performance view of strike rate and delivered ratio. The Live Route Monitor shows every van while it’s still moving.

Bring surveys, cold-chain readings and batch movements into one report you can hand to an auditor as-is. Field data aggregates itself, so there is no rebuilding from scratch.

Break down commission, promo effectiveness and wastage by driver, store and SKU. Every figure is returns-aware and reconciled to the ledger, so you can defend it.

See who changed what, when and from where, with version comparison on a tamper-resistant log. Audit packs assemble themselves, so external reviews stop being a fire drill.
Representative results when operational reporting runs off the ledger, not the export.
Covetrus moved its delivery operation off paper sheets, manual data entry and end-of-day signed dockets returned to the depot. Every one of the 200+ daily deliveries is now verified to the correct location and searchable from the Back-Office — signatures, photos, timestamps and geo-fenced confirmations — with exceptions flagged live on the Route Monitor map. The audit trail that used to take a week to assemble is now a filtered export, and delivery delays are down 87%.
When the audit pack, the recall query or the per-route picture decides the month. Find your industry to see the fit.
Per-SKU promo lift, per-route delivered ratio and daily commission visibility for branded distributors.
Explore industryBatch-level traceability, recall queries in minutes and regulator-ready audit packs.
Explore industryPer-client cost-to-serve, SLA accuracy and a paperless POD trail across mixed fleets.
Explore industryDemand & shortfall reports for short shelf-life rounds where wastage is the margin.
Explore industryAuditable cold-chain temperature reports plus per-route plan-vs-delivered for daily runs.
Explore industryPer-customer balance drill-down and on-account collection trail for restaurant and hotel buyers.
Explore industryPer-branch parts ledger, per-cashier accuracy and warranty / return analytics.
Explore industryPer-site delivery proof, per-job cost roll-up and consignment-stock reconciliation.
Explore industry| Capability | Spreadsheet stack | RouteMagic Reporting & Analytics |
|---|---|---|
| Report freshness | 1 day lag at best. | Live — refreshes on each transaction. |
| Drill-down depth | Stops at the pivot row. | Balance → invoice → cheque photo → geo-stamp. |
| Per-driver picture | Lives in the supervisor’s head. | Live leaderboard & per-driver accuracy report. |
| Audit-pack assembly | ~1 week of PDF-stitching. | Minutes — filtered export from Audit Log. |
| Commission disputes | 3 days a month to resolve. | ~1 hour, returns-aware engine. |
| Per-branch reconciliation | Manual roll-up, end of month. | Branch Deposit closes daily, per-cashier accuracy. |
Start on the plan that fits today and move up as you grow — same platform, same data.
£29/ monthly / user
The starter plan — essential capabilities to get a single team up and running.
Get Started£39/ monthly / user
The complete platform to run your operation end to end — where most teams start.
Get Started£59/ monthly / user
Everything in Core, plus advanced analytics, multi-site scale and priority support.
Get StartedRouteMagic solutions that feed the ledgers and dashboards — or read from them.
Anomaly detection, forecast and natural-language queries on top of the same ledger.
Explore solutionBin Transactions, batch tracking and cycle counts — the data the inventory ledger reports on.
Explore solutionLive van positions, geo-fenced arrivals and route telemetry feeding Route History.
Explore solutionCapture, validate and route every order — the pipeline the dashboards report on.
Explore solutionThe ones that come up most often. Book a walkthrough for anything else.
The ones that change the morning meeting: a live operations dashboard, the delivery performance dashboard (plan vs delivered per route, per-driver delivered ratio), aged-debt and per-branch cash, daily commission, and the audit log. These are the fleet management reporting and delivery KPIs teams check every day, all reading the same ledger rather than a stale overnight export.
An audit trail is an unalterable record of who did what, when and from where. Built on an append-only ledger, every load, sale, payment and route action is written once and never overwritten — so you can drill from a balance straight to the source document, cheque photo and geo-stamp, and prove the figure rather than vouch for it. That is the difference between a report you trust and one you hope is right.
An FMIS is the single system that holds your fleet, route, delivery, stock and cost data and reports on it. RouteMagic acts as that operational system of record: every movement posts to source, and the reporting layer reads from it live — no separate spreadsheet or BI rebuild to keep it current.
Yes — every report exports to CSV, XLSX and PDF, and most can be scheduled as an email digest. Filtered views keep their filters on export.
Yes. From a customer balance you drill to the invoice; from the invoice to the line items, the cheque photo, the geo-stamp, the driver and the timestamp. From a bin quantity you drill to the receipt, transfer, pick or adjustment that moved it. Nothing is rolled-up first.
Both. Every ledger is branch-aware, so you can run per-branch cash, per-branch inventory and per-cashier accuracy in isolation, then roll up to tenant-level for consolidated reporting.
Audit Log is append-only and hash-chained — edits leave a footprint. Default retention is seven years; longer retention is configurable per tenant for regulated industries.
Yes. Returns and credit notes adjust commission in the same cycle, so you don’t pay out on a sale that came back the next day. Backdated returns reverse cleanly; mid-month rule changes are supported. Commission and wastage reporting is part of the daily round in van sales software.
Yes. Per-stop temperature readings, out-of-range alerts and reefer downtime build an auditable cold-chain trail you can export as a regulator-ready PDF. The same field data covers batch traceability and recall. See the fit for dairy, FMCG and pharmaceutical, and the batch and stock side in inventory management.
Yes. RouteMagic is your operational reporting system, not a replacement for your BI stack — and the two connect. We expose a REST API and scheduled CSV / Parquet exports for data warehousing; customers stream into Looker, Power BI, BigQuery, Snowflake and Metabase today.
Thank you
Your request has been received.